Review: Lululemon Strongfeel Training Shoe

The Strongfeel, with a streamlined silhouette defined by rounded contours and cutouts, is designed for strength training, it has a flat sole with low-profile cushioning and a higher back which stabilizes the heel and provides an anchored sensation. The upper is surprisingly lightweight but also hugs the feet securely, while the slightly curved outsole provides traction for plyometric exercises.
